We are looking for a collaborative, self-starter, with infrastructure project experience to join our London Infrastructure Major Projects team.
What you’ll be doing as an Assistant Project Manager:
- Providing Project Managers with support to deliver project outcomes for our current 5 year AMP and on a future portfolio of projects.
- Drive project delivery to time cost and outcome through the stage gate process.
- Delivering successful technical solutions that provide optimal value for money on a capital and whole-life cost basis.
- Performance managing the service providers to ensure out-performance of service levels and value for money.
- Establish and continuously promote a proactive health, safety & environment culture across projects.
- Leading a customer-focused culture that is unrelenting in its pursuit of excellence in service delivery to internal and external customers.
- Proactively ensuring every customer touch point is a positive experience to remember.
- Actively protecting, managing, and enhancing Thames Water’s reputation to external customers and stakeholders.
Location - This hybrid role is based from our Maple Lodge Offices. You will need to attend both the office and various operational sites as required for the position and business need, which will be around two days a week.
Hours - The work schedule is 36 hours a week, Monday to Friday. A driver's license and access to a vehicle are required for this position.
To thrive in this role the essential criteria are:
- Project experience from significant infrastructure projects, ideally within the water and waste sector.
- Organised, resilient and tenacious, with proven experience of managing the performance of third-party service providers and contractors.
- Project Management skills, attention to detail and precise.
- Collaborative approach, good communication skills with contractors and stakeholders.
- A self-starter, with a willingness to come forward and take responsibility.
- Continuous promotion of proactive health, safety & environment culture.
- Experience in proactive management of project risk.
- A strong customer service ethic, measurement of customer satisfaction and a proven track record of delivering improvement for customers.
